Escalating Espionage Threats and Legal Proceedings
This chapter explores the legal ramifications of a woman accused of espionage in Australia, including the court's bail denial over flight risk concerns. It highlights increasing foreign interference threats, particularly from China, Iran, and Russia, and emphasizes the need for Australia to strengthen its defenses against such espionage operations.
